Title: The Innovations of Rudiger Heine
Introduction
Rudiger Heine is a notable inventor based in Lengerich,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of aquatic animal nutrition through his innovative flake feed patents. With a total of two patents to his name, Heine's work has garnered attention in the industry.
Latest Patents
Heine's latest patents focus on novel flake feeds specifically designed for aquatic animals, including fish, shrimps, and invertebrates. These flakes are characterized by their uniform form, variable thickness, and a water content ranging from 1 to 30%. The patents also detail a process for the production of these specialized feeds, highlighting their importance in enhancing the health and growth of aquatic species.
